Ahly Killers Set To Inflict More Woes On Kwara United In Ilorin Showdown


Kwara United will attempt to shrug off their away defeat at the hands of Kaduna United, when they return to the Ilorin International stadium, The Afonja Warriors have also lost their last three games and need a win to get back on track against second placed Kano Pillars.
Last weekend’s 2-1 away defeat to Kaduna United compounded the Ilorin based outfit woes and they are just four points off the relegation zone.
Pillars that defeated league leaders, Rangers International of Enugu 2-0 in Kano last week, go into the tie looking for their first away win of the season which could see them topple Rangers at the summit.


The Ahly killer however faces a daunting task here as they have not won in their last six visits to the Ilorin Township Stadium.
Kwara United have also won five of their last home games but the fact that they lost their last against local rivals, Abubakar Bukola Saraki Football Club would give the visitors hope of leaving Ilorin unscathed.
Pillars Coach Baba Ganaru foresees a very difficult afternoon for his lads but is confident they can weather the storm.


“We are good enough to be champions of the league this season after our win against Rangers, but we need not be over confident because we still trail our leaders by three points.
“This weekend encounter against Kwara United will be very crucial, knowing that a win here will help us in the fight for silver ware this season,” Baba Ganaru stated.
